WebStrain Counterstrain was developed in 1955 by Dr. Lawrence Jones, an osteopath from the small town of Ontario, Oregon. Dr. Jones was born and raised in Spokane, Washington, the son of an engineer and school teacher. As a teenager, he became interested in osteopathy after watching an osteopath treat his friend’s acute back injury and provide ... WebJan 7, 2024 · Simply put, fascia is fiberous connective tissue that is comprised of collagen and protects your organs and muscles. (Come to think of it, it’s kind of like the inner layer of a banana peel.) Fascia supports our musculoskeletal system so we can perform activities like walking, running and sitting at a desk for eight-plus hours. WebOct 12, 2024 · Fascia stretching is said to give you a feeling of deep relaxation and rejuvenation that no other regular Swedish massage could ever do. The technique was developed by Ann Frederick, the first "flexibility specialist" to work with athletes at the Olympics, and it aims to improve every aspect of athletic performance and recovery.
